Upload
phamdat
View
223
Download
1
Embed Size (px)
Citation preview
1
Linde Engineering
Oracle-Upgrade auf
die Version 10g in der
Linde-KCA-Dresden GmbH
LINDE-KCA-DRESDEN GMBHDresden, 18. Mai 2006Klaus-Peter Bräuer, DBA
Linde Engineering
2 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Linde Gas und Engineering Linde Material Handling
Der Linde Konzern
LG LE LMH
Linde Engineering
3 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Der Linde KonzernUnternehmensbereich Gas und Engineering
Produktpalette
— Petrochemieanlagen
— Wasserstoff-/ Synthesegasanlagen
— Luftzerlegungsanlagen
— Pharmazieanlagen
— Umweltanlagen
— Fertigung von Anlagen-komponenten und -modulen
Geschäftsbereich Linde Engineering
Linde Engineering
4 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Der Linde KonzernUnternehmensbereich Gas und Engineering
Projektierung
Projektierung kann umfassen:
vom Kundenauftrag bis zur schlüsselfertigen Übergabe
oder
nur Einzelschritte im Projekt
Daraus ergeben sich Baustellen unterschiedlichster Ausprägung, die mit LKCA in Dresden vernetzt sind.
Geschäftsbereich Linde Engineering
Linde Engineering
5 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Linde-KCA-Dresden GmbH
Hauptsitz in Dresden, der sächsischen Landeshauptstadt
Standorte in der Bodenbacher Straße und der Wilsdruffer Straße
Linde Engineering
6 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Verwendung der Datenbanken
Was machen wir mit den Datenbanken in einem Engineering-Unternehmen?
CAD : Intergraph Plant Design System 2D, Intergraph Plant Design System 3D,
Intergraph SmartPlant 2D, Intergraph SmartPlant 3D
LE: Baustellensystem -> Site Administration System
CAE: Instrumentierungs-Software (z.B. INTOOLS)
weitere CAE-Applikationen
Dokumentenmanagement mit Documentum
Management: zentrale Oracle Namensauflösung
Job- und Event-System des OEM mit Erweiterungs-Paketen
DBArtisan für das Tagesgeschäft (von Embarcadero)
2
Linde Engineering
7 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Ausgangszustand im März 2005
Linde Engineering
8 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Herausforderungen bei der Umstellung
- Jeder PC erhält bei uns einen mehrteiligen Standard Client (7.3.4 bis 8.1.7) einschließlich der
Runtime-Komponenten des Developer 6i und des Discoverer (8.0).
- In Applikationen eingebettete Clients (Baustellensystem, 8.0).
- Zentrale Namensauflösung bei Version 10g nicht mehr ONS sondern OID.
- EM 10g erfordert zwingend neue EM Agenten für Oracle 8i und 9i Datenbanken.
- Oracle liefert die Windows Versionen zu spät aus,
Windows als Management-Plattform nicht stabil genug,
deshalb Suse Linux SLES9 als Management-Plattform.
- Manuelle Migration der verschiedensten Applikationen.
- Keine Lehrgänge für Oracle 9i und 10g zuvor.
- Zertifizierung der Applikationen gegen 10g zögerlich.
- OID für Namensauflösung viel zu großer Overhead.
- Parallelbetrieb von Umstellungstest und Produktion: keine Ausfälle.
- Anwender qualifizieren.
Linde Engineering
9 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Ablauf der Umstellung im Jahr 2005
Gründe: Ablösung von Server Hardware, Oracle 9i war schon länger auf dem Markt,
Oracle 10g war etabliert -> Patch 10.1.0.4 war brauchbar
Plan: Oracle8i Datenbanken nach 10g (10.1.0.4) umstellen und Oracle 9i überspringen
Oracle Enterprise Manager von Version 9i nach Version 10g Rel.1umstellen
Oracle Internet Directory 10g Rel.1 zur Namensauflösung für Oracle Net 10g
Oracle Names Server 8i und 9i für Namensauflösung beibehalten
Alle existierenden und zukünftigen Oracle 8i und 9i Datenbanken mit EM Agents 10g
versehen.
Linde Engineering
10 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Plan und Wirklichkeit
Smart Plant 2D
INTOOLS
Site Administration
System
Smart Plant 3D
Linde Engineering
11 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Soll-Zustand Ende 2005
Linde Engineering
12 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Ablauf der Umstellung im Jahr 2006
Datenbanken: Standard für Oracle 10g Rel.2, geprägt durch produktives Smart Plant 3D
keine Konsolidierung von Smart Plant 2D/3D auf 10.2 – weil 2D nicht zertifiziert
Standard für Site Administration System auf Oracle 9i 9.2.0.7
Evaluierung der Oracle Express Edition für kleine Anwendungen
Management: Grid Control/Enterprise Manager 10g Rel.2 & Patches auf SLES9
Oracle Internet Directory 10g Rel.2 auf R2 SLES9 (im OAS enthalten)
- aus taktischen Gründen auf separatem Server
Upgrade aller Oracle Names Server auf 9i und Konfiguration als Oracle Names
LDAP Proxy Server, damit nur Verwaltung der Konfiguration an einer Stelle
Oracle11g: ????
3
Linde Engineering
13 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Soll-Zustand 2. Etappe Ende 2006
Linde Engineering
14 KA-W/LKCA-Praesentation_D.potLinde-KCA-Dresden GmbH
Linde Engineering
Erfahrungen
Gute: Performance und Stabilität der Datenbanken
Manuelle Migration ohne Probleme
Migration gekaufter Applikationen ohne Probleme
EM Akzeptanz (Jobs, Events, Performance) trotz Interface Wechsel
Database Scheduler Jobs
automatisches Erstellen der Statistiken
automatisierte Konfiguration
Schlechte: EM zu wenig Funktionalität (z.B. kein exp/imp bzw. Data Pump in Jobs möglich)
Oracle Names Server vs. Oracle Internet Directory (Overhead, Verfügbarkeit)
Inkompatibilität zwischen …9i und 10g bei EM und Namensauflösung
EM: Interface Wechsel, sehr komplex
Release 10.2 verhält sich anders als Release 1, keine Konsolidierung möglich
Windows 32bit: bei ca. 1,7 GB (2,2 GB) Prozessgröße -> mysteriöse Fehler
Linde Engineering
Vielen Dank
für Ihre Aufmerksamkeit
Fragen ?
LINDE-KCA-DRESDEN GMBH